Today's Text: II Corinthians 1-8-10

I. Stress-What is it?
Some event so stressful caused Paul to share his heavy burden with the Corinthians.
Whether it was the dangerous riot that had occurred in Ephesus (Acts 19:23-41), or some grave sickness, or some disturbing news from Corinth we don’t know. Yet, he openly shared his humanness with them.
